超並列プログラム言語のコンパイル技法に関する基礎研究

大规模并行编程语言编译技术基础研究

基本信息

  • 批准号:
    07680357
  • 负责人:
  • 金额:
    $ 1.41万
  • 依托单位:
  • 依托单位国家:
    日本
  • 项目类别:
    Grant-in-Aid for General Scientific Research (C)
  • 财政年份:
    1995
  • 资助国家:
    日本
  • 起止时间:
    1995 至 无数据
  • 项目状态:
    已结题

项目摘要

共有メモリ型並列計算機シリコングラフイックス社製Challengeおよび分散共有メモリ型並列計算機富士通社製AP1000で稼働するSPMD(Single Program Multi Data)型の並列プログラムの性能解析し,実行速度を向上させるためのいくつかの知見を得た.(1)従来,配列添字を解析することによって効率良くデータを分割する方法が提案されている.この方法では1つの要素データがデータ転送の単位とされている.しかし,Challengeを含み多くの並列計算機での転送単位はブロックである.そこで,ブロック単位で何度転送が行われるかをプログラムの配列添字式を分析して求め,それに基づきデータ分割の方法を決めることにより,従来方法より並列プログラムが効率のよく稼働することを理論的に示し,また実際に応用プログラムを実行してそれを確認した.また,仮想メモリアドレスから実メモリアドレスを計算するときに使用されるTLB(Translation Look-aside Buffer)へのアクセスもデータへのアクセス同様に性能分析の対象に含めるべきであるという結果を得た.(2)AP1000の全複製による分散共有メモリの効率のよい実現法を考案した.この方法は部分放送という手法を用いる.応用プログラムのリ-ド比率(共有メモリに対するアクセスのうち,readの回数とwriteの回数に関するある比率)を定義し,その値により本提案手法が多くの場合効果的であることを理論的に示した.また,実際に512台のプロセッサをもつAP1000上で実測し,理論値とほぼ一致することを確認した.さらに,通信の一括化による高速化方法を考案し,その効果も確認した.今後の課題は,これらの提案方法が他のアーキテクチャの並列計算機でどの程度効果があるかを確認することが挙げられる。
The performance analysis of SPMD(Single Program Multi Data) type parallel computer, and the knowledge of its running speed are obtained. (1)The method of dividing the characters into two parts is proposed. This method is to change the number of elements in the file. The Challenge contains multiple parallel computers, and each computer has its own unique location. For example, if a user wants to use a computer, he or she may not be able to use the computer. For example, if a user wants to use a computer, he or she may not be able to use the computer. In addition, the Translation Look-aside Buffer (TLB) is used to calculate the translation Look-aside value of the translation Look-aside buffer. (2) AP1000's full replication, distributed sharing, and efficiency realization are examined. This method is not part of the transmission. The ratio of the total number of cycles of reading to the number of cycles of writing is defined by the ratio of the total number of cycles of reading to the number of cycles of writing. 512 units were tested on the AP1000, and the theoretical value was confirmed. In this paper, the communication of a high-speed method of research, and the results confirmed. In the future, the problem is to propose a method for determining the extent of parallel computing.

项目成果

期刊论文数量(6)
专著数量(0)
科研奖励数量(0)
会议论文数量(0)
专利数量(0)
藤本典幸: "トーラスマシン上での分散共有メモリの実現について" 日本ソフトウェア科学会第12回大会論文集. 5-8 (1995)
Noriyuki Fujimoto:“环面机器上分布式共享内存的实现”日本软件学会第 12 届年会论文集 5-8 (1995)。
  • DOI:
  • 发表时间:
  • 期刊:
  • 影响因子:
    0
  • 作者:
  • 通讯作者:
濱田武志: "ある共有メモリ型並列計算機でのキャッシュを考慮したプロセッサ割り当てについて" 日本ソフトウェア科学会第12回大会論文集. 93-96 (1995)
Takeshi Hamada:“考虑共享内存并行计算机中的缓存的处理器分配”日本软件学会第 12 届年会论文集 93-96 (1995)。
  • DOI:
  • 发表时间:
  • 期刊:
  • 影响因子:
    0
  • 作者:
  • 通讯作者:
荻原兼一: "並列・分散アルゴリズム" コロナ社, 200 (1996)
Kenichi Ogiwara:“并行/分布式算法” Coronasha,200 (1996)
  • DOI:
  • 发表时间:
  • 期刊:
  • 影响因子:
    0
  • 作者:
  • 通讯作者:
{{ item.title }}
{{ item.translation_title }}
  • DOI:
    {{ item.doi }}
  • 发表时间:
    {{ item.publish_year }}
  • 期刊:
  • 影响因子:
    {{ item.factor }}
  • 作者:
    {{ item.authors }}
  • 通讯作者:
    {{ item.author }}

数据更新时间:{{ journalArticles.updateTime }}

{{ item.title }}
  • 作者:
    {{ item.author }}

数据更新时间:{{ monograph.updateTime }}

{{ item.title }}
  • 作者:
    {{ item.author }}

数据更新时间:{{ sciAawards.updateTime }}

{{ item.title }}
  • 作者:
    {{ item.author }}

数据更新时间:{{ conferencePapers.updateTime }}

{{ item.title }}
  • 作者:
    {{ item.author }}

数据更新时间:{{ patent.updateTime }}

荻原 兼一其他文献

荻原 兼一的其他文献

{{ item.title }}
{{ item.translation_title }}
  • DOI:
    {{ item.doi }}
  • 发表时间:
    {{ item.publish_year }}
  • 期刊:
  • 影响因子:
    {{ item.factor }}
  • 作者:
    {{ item.authors }}
  • 通讯作者:
    {{ item.author }}

相似海外基金

メニーコア・メニーノードに対応する実用的共有メモリ型並列計算基盤
支持多核多节点的实用共享内存并行计算平台
  • 批准号:
    23K21652
  • 财政年份:
    2024
  • 资助金额:
    $ 1.41万
  • 项目类别:
    Grant-in-Aid for Scientific Research (B)
Education and Outreach using the MicroPulse Differential Absorption Lidars (MPD) and NYSM Profiler Network before, during, and after the 2024 Total Solar Eclipse
在 2024 年日全食之前、期间和之后使用微脉冲差分吸收激光雷达 (MPD) 和 NYSM 剖面仪网络进行教育和推广
  • 批准号:
    2345420
  • 财政年份:
    2024
  • 资助金额:
    $ 1.41万
  • 项目类别:
    Standard Grant
Combinatorics of Total Positivity: Amplituhedra and Braid Varieties
总正性的组合:幅面体和辫子品种
  • 批准号:
    2349015
  • 财政年份:
    2024
  • 资助金额:
    $ 1.41万
  • 项目类别:
    Standard Grant
Solar Eclipse Workshop: Observations of April 2024 Total Solar Eclipse and Community Discussion of Multi-Scale Coupling in Geospace Environment; Arlington, Texas; April 8-10, 2024
日食研讨会:2024年4月日全食观测及地球空间环境多尺度耦合的社区讨论;
  • 批准号:
    2415082
  • 财政年份:
    2024
  • 资助金额:
    $ 1.41万
  • 项目类别:
    Standard Grant
The influences of size reduction of a Total Artificial Heart on fluid dynamics and blood compatibility.
全人工心脏尺寸减小对流体动力学和血液相容性的影响。
  • 批准号:
    2903462
  • 财政年份:
    2024
  • 资助金额:
    $ 1.41万
  • 项目类别:
    Studentship
CAREER: Real-time control of elementary catalytic steps: Controlling total vs partial electrocatalytic oxidation of alkanes and olefins
职业:实时控制基本催化步骤:控制烷烃和烯烃的全部与部分电催化氧化
  • 批准号:
    2338627
  • 财政年份:
    2024
  • 资助金额:
    $ 1.41万
  • 项目类别:
    Continuing Grant
Machine learning algorithm to predict the postoperative activity in total knee arthroplasty patients
机器学习算法预测全膝关节置换术患者术后活动
  • 批准号:
    23K10518
  • 财政年份:
    2023
  • 资助金额:
    $ 1.41万
  • 项目类别:
    Grant-in-Aid for Scientific Research (C)
easuring the wear of a new, all-polymer PEEK-OPTIMA femoral knee component for total knee replacement
减轻全膝关节置换术中新型全聚合物 PEEK-OPTIMA 股骨膝关节组件的磨损
  • 批准号:
    2885506
  • 财政年份:
    2023
  • 资助金额:
    $ 1.41万
  • 项目类别:
    Studentship
Collaborative Research: Citizen CATE Next-Generation 2024 Total Solar Eclipse Experiment, Phase 2
合作研究:Citizen CATE 下一代 2024 年日全食实验,第二阶段
  • 批准号:
    2308306
  • 财政年份:
    2023
  • 资助金额:
    $ 1.41万
  • 项目类别:
    Standard Grant
Development of non-invasive smartphone based navigation system for total hip arthroplasty.
开发基于智能手机的非侵入性全髋关节置换术导航系统。
  • 批准号:
    23K15709
  • 财政年份:
    2023
  • 资助金额:
    $ 1.41万
  • 项目类别:
    Grant-in-Aid for Early-Career Scientists
{{ showInfoDetail.title }}

作者:{{ showInfoDetail.author }}

知道了